Construction Walls Seal Off Fantasyland Behind Cinderella Castle
New construction barriers installed on April 6 have effectively closed off a section of Fantasyland behind Cinderella Castle at Magic Kingdom, blocking one of the park’s most iconic sightlines.
Walt Disney World Resort erected new construction walls in Fantasyland on Monday, surrounding the area directly behind Cinderella Castle and restricting guest access to that portion of the land. The move is consistent with ongoing backstage and show building work in the castle hub area, though Disney has not specified the project behind the new barriers. Guests arriving this week will notice the walls on approach to the castle from the Fantasyland side, and the construction footprint covers a portion of the walking area between the castle and the Fantasyland attractions corridor. Disney has yet to announce a completion timeline.

Tony Baxter Breaks Silence: Bring Back Splash Mountain, Ditch Buzz Lightyear
Legendary Imagineer Tony Baxter spoke out at a Walt Disney Family Museum event celebrating the 31st anniversary of Indiana Jones Adventure, calling for Splash Mountain’s return and naming Buzz Lightyear Space Ranger Spin as the attraction he’d remove.

Six Flags Completes Sale of Seven Parks to EPR Properties
Six Flags has finalized the sale of seven of its parks to EPR Properties as part of a strategic streamlining effort, reshaping the major theme park operator’s portfolio going into the summer season.
